Step 1: Plan Your Manufacturing AI Strategy in ClickUp
Before adding tools, define what AI should accomplish for your manufacturing operations. Use a structured planning area inside ClickUp to capture goals, constraints, and requirements.
Create a ClickUp Space for Manufacturing AI
-
Create a new Space and name it something like Manufacturing AI or Smart Factory Initiatives.
-
Add a description outlining your goals, such as reducing downtime, improving quality control, or optimizing supply chain decisions.
-
Set user permissions so operations, engineering, IT, and leadership can collaborate in one place.
Document AI Use Cases and Requirements
Within the Space, create a List called AI Use Cases. For each idea, make a task that includes:
-
Business problem (for example, unplanned machine downtime)
-
Proposed AI solution (predictive maintenance, visual defect detection, demand forecasting)
-
Data needed (sensor readings, images, ERP data, MES logs)
-
Expected impact (cycle time, OEE, scrap rate, energy consumption)
Use custom fields to capture priority, estimated ROI, and implementation complexity. This gives you a portfolio view of all AI projects in ClickUp.
Step 2: Organize AI Projects in ClickUp Views
Clear structure is essential in manufacturing, so mirror your existing processes with standardized views inside ClickUp.
Build a ClickUp Kanban Board for AI Initiatives
Create a List called AI Projects and switch to Board view. Add columns such as:
-
Backlog
-
Discovery
-
Pilot
-
Production
-
Monitoring & Improvement
Each card represents an AI project, like a computer vision inspection pilot or planning optimization system. Use tags for areas like maintenance, quality, inventory, and supply chain.
Use List and Table Views for Manufacturing Stakeholders
Switch to List or Table view so engineering leaders and plant managers can track details quickly. Include columns for:
-
Owner or champion
-
Target line or facility
-
Key metric (scrap, throughput, OEE, lead time)
-
Go-live date
-
Status and risk rating
These views help teams see how AI initiatives align with existing production schedules and capacity constraints.
Step 3: Capture Manufacturing Data and Processes in ClickUp Docs
AI in manufacturing depends on clear, accurate documentation. Use Docs inside ClickUp to create living process and data handbooks.
Standardize AI-Ready Manufacturing Processes
Create a Doc called Production Process Library and break it into sections for each product family or line. For every process, document:
-
Step-by-step workflow, including machine steps and manual tasks
-
Data generated at each step (sensor streams, images, measurements, timestamps)
-
Quality checkpoints and tolerances
-
Existing systems (MES, ERP, SCADA, QMS)
Link specific sections of the Doc to related production or improvement tasks. This gives AI specialists and engineers shared context without hunting through multiple systems.
Document AI Tool Evaluations in ClickUp
When you evaluate AI tools for manufacturing, create a Doc for each vendor or open-source option. Include:
-
Capabilities (vision inspection, predictive maintenance, forecasting, scheduling)
-
Required integrations
-
Security and compliance notes
-
Pilot results and performance metrics

Step 4: Turn AI Ideas into Executable Tasks in ClickUp
Once your ideas and tools are defined, convert them into actionable project plans inside ClickUp so teams know who is doing what and when.
Create Task Templates for AI Pilots
Standardize pilot projects using reusable task templates in ClickUp. For each AI pilot type, create a task with:
-
Checklist for scoping and data access
-
Checklist for model development or configuration
-
Checklist for factory floor testing and validation
-
Acceptance criteria tied to measurable metrics
Save these as templates and apply them whenever a new AI use case moves into pilot stage, ensuring consistent quality and governance.
Break Down AI Workstreams for Manufacturing Teams
For each project, create subtasks (or nested subtasks) that reflect manufacturing reality, such as:
-
IT: Set up data connectors and secure access
-
Engineering: Define technical requirements and constraints
-
Operations: Validate workflows and train operators
-
Quality: Define sampling plans and test procedures
Use timelines or Gantt view in ClickUp to align project milestones with planned shutdowns, maintenance windows, or product changeovers.
Step 5: Use ClickUp Automation to Support AI-Driven Production
Automation inside ClickUp can mirror rules in your manufacturing environment, ensuring AI projects progress without constant manual chasing.
Set Up Status and Notification Automations in ClickUp
Configure automations so that:
-
When a task moves to Pilot, key stakeholders get notified automatically.
-
When a due date is at risk, ClickUp posts a comment requesting an update.
-
When a task is marked as Ready for Production, a follow-up task is created for documentation and training.
This keeps AI efforts aligned with daily manufacturing operations without adding extra administrative work.
Link AI Insights Back into ClickUp
As AI systems generate alerts or optimization recommendations, capture the actions in tasks so nothing is missed. Examples include:
-
Creating tasks when predictive maintenance alerts exceed a threshold
-
Logging root-cause investigations for recurring defects identified by vision systems
-
Tracking schedule changes driven by demand forecasts
Over time, this history becomes a knowledge base that informs future AI and process improvements.
Step 6: Monitor Performance and Iterate in ClickUp
Continuous improvement is central to manufacturing, and the same principle applies to AI workflows. Use dashboards and reports inside ClickUp to monitor results and refine your approach.
Build ClickUp Dashboards for Manufacturing Metrics
Create dashboards tailored to different roles. Include widgets that track:
-
Number of active AI projects by line or plant
-
On-time delivery of pilots and production rollouts
-
Impact on metrics such as scrap, throughput, or downtime
Combine these insights with your existing manufacturing KPIs to decide where to expand or adjust AI deployments.
Review and Improve AI Projects Regularly
Schedule recurring review tasks in ClickUp to evaluate each AI solution after go-live. In those tasks, capture:
-
Actual versus targeted performance
-
Operator feedback and training needs
-
Required model or configuration updates
-
Opportunities to replicate success on other lines
Use comments and attachments to store screenshots, reports, and charts so every stakeholder has one source of truth for decision-making.
